Well, you can restrict it with -emin   or -all to a certain energy 
range, eventually to a single eigenvalue.

It will still be a huge file with many radial functions and alm,blm and 
clms.

PS: Honestly, I havn't used the -alm option for years, so there's a 
chance it is not correct.
At least I have some reports from the DMFT community, that the latest 
versions have a problem.

> Is there a built-in procedure to extract a single real-space wave 
> function (both inside MTs and in interstitial region), in the native 
> LAPW representation, for a single En(k) point?
> 
> In a way, this is what lapw7 is doing, but it projects it onto the 
> Cartesian grid. I would like to have it in the native representation 
> (Ylms inside MTs, and PWs in the interstitial).
> 
> I know one can do lapw2 -alm, but this (as far as I understand) will 
> export all energies, so the output will be a big file for the slab, even 
> for a single k.
